Account id: 95577463
Steam id: 153122396016108919
LAST MATCH
MATCH RESULTS
LANE RESULTS
2
50.0%
2.3
18%
1005
737
148
39:58
59309587
12d ago
Match won
Lane won
8 / 8 / 26
657
155
42:34
59286574
Match lost
Lane lost
4 / 14 / 12
828
140
37:21
Clow
1
0.0%
UnstableJenny